**Runbook: Retrying failed exports (Lanternfish reports)**

Welcome aboard! When a nightly export to the Corvid warehouse fails, don't panic — most failures are transient. First, requeue the job from the Lanternfish admin panel and wait ten minutes. If it fails twice, escalate to the data on-call. Always attach the export's trace token to the escalation; you'll find it directly below.

session token of tajog-fahaf = htk21_4ae55819f45410afcb307

[ ] Key ceremony — Liftwright elevator-dispatch simulator. Confirm both custodians from the Marrowfield team are present before unsealing the simulator's signing enclave. Verify the dispatch-model checksum against last week's sync notes, rotate the quorum shares, and log the ceremony in the Tolliver register. The simulator will refuse replayed dispatch traces signed with retired keys. Once quorum is confirmed, the operator should read aloud the recovery passphrase printed below.

unlock words, fadug-tageg: zorix-wenwyn-quenmir

Ticket: Missed pick-up — Brindle & Voss Print Works

Hey, the courier never showed at Brindle & Voss this morning for the master copies of the Larkspur catalogue run. Their front desk waited until noon, then flagged it with us. These are the only clean masters, so we can't just reship duplicates. Can you get a driver rerouted there before they close at six? Marisol at their counter will have the package bagged and ready. Below is the hand-over instruction for the driver.

dispatch memo: the lamwyn fenwyn courier leaves the wenir ledger at gate 7175 under passcode 822969

Leadership Review Briefing — Branch Managers

Treasury recommends hedging sixty percent of next year's crown-denominated receivables from the Varsholm distribution deal using forward contracts. Spot exposure last quarter cost Merrowline an estimated two points of margin. The committee weighed options collars but found premiums unattractive. Ratification is expected at Thursday's review. The confidential business context for this decision appears below.

board note of bafog-taduf: Gross margin on Oliath came in at 5 percent against a plan of 5 percent. Only 9 of the 120 pilot accounts renewed Oliath, so a churn review is set for January 15.